JavaScript声明变量

js属于弱类型语言

js里的变量:

Number  1,1.1,-2,-3 数字是Number
String '字符串' "字符串"
Boolean 只有true和false两个值
Array数组 []    1,2,23,"5dsd",'7878dsfs',["djaf56",'a']  中括号是数组
Object对象 {}   {name:"小明",age:34}
undefined 未赋值
none 空

输出:
console.log("1"==1)
 
 

在 JavaScript 中创建变量通常称为"声明"变量。

我们使用 var 关键词来声明变量:

var carname;

变量声明之后,该变量是空的(它没有值)。

如需向变量赋值,请使用等号:

carname="Volvo";

不过,您也可以在声明变量时对其赋值:

var carname="Volvo";

在下面的例子中,我们创建了名为 carname 的变量,并向其赋值 "Volvo",然后把它放入 id="demo" 的 HTML 段落中:

实例

var carname="Volvo"; document.getElementById("demo").innerHTML=carname;
 
还可以是数字、数组、字符串
var a=1
var b="23"
var c=[]
var d={}
var a=1,b="23"
var a,b=2
 

变量名规则:
1.由大小写字母、数字、下划线和美元符号($)组成
2.不能以数字开头
3.严格区分大小写 it和IT是两个变量
4.不能使用JavaScript中的关键字(在JavaScript中有特殊意义的词)和保留字(js暂时用不到但是将来可能会用到的词)命名
5.要尽量做到见其名,知其意
6.多个词组成的一个变量名,建议使用小驼峰命名法
 
posted @ 2021-11-21 22:54  粥周  阅读(151)  评论(0)    收藏  举报